Exercising: lunging, hacking, or thoroughly working your horse
Training: working with a horse in regards to a certain discipline (hunter, jumper, dressage, some western); eliminating vices and improving behavior and respect
Backing: preparing a (young) horse to carry a rider; starting and finishing him/her under saddle
Rehabbing: following the Vet's instructions in order to put a horse back to work after an injury
